IThemeResolutionService Interfaccia
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Fornisce un'interfaccia utilizzabile dagli sviluppatori di strumenti di progettazione per fornire un set di oggetti ThemeProvider, che possono essere utilizzati per applicare interfacce del controllo e temi ai controlli in un ambiente di progettazione.
public interface class IThemeResolutionService
public interface IThemeResolutionService
type IThemeResolutionService = interface
Public Interface IThemeResolutionService
Commenti
Gli sviluppatori di pagine e gli autori di controlli non usano IThemeResolutionService l'interfaccia . IThemeResolutionServiceL'interfaccia viene implementata dagli sviluppatori di strumenti di progettazione per fornire SkinBuilder generatori di controlli nell'ambiente di progettazione.
è un contenitore per uno o più oggetti , che a sua volta forniscono gli oggetti che applicano temi e interfaccia del controllo ai controlli quando vengono IThemeResolutionService creati in una finestra di ThemeProvider SkinBuilder progettazione. È possibile accedere a IThemeResolutionService un'istanza della classe da una determinata ControlBuilder istanza usando la relativa proprietà ControlBuilder.ThemeResolutionService .
Metodi
GetAllThemeProviders() |
Ottiene una matrice Array di oggetti ThemeProvider. |
GetStylesheetThemeProvider() |
Ottiene un oggetto ThemeProvider che rappresenta il tema di personalizzazione in un foglio di stile. |
GetThemeProvider() |
Ottiene un oggetto ThemeProvider che rappresenta il tema di personalizzazione in una pagina ASP.NET. |